。
答:要实现这个需求,可以使用动态表单的方式来创建具有未定义数量的视图的表单。动态表单允许用户根据需要动态地添加或删除字段,以适应不同的情况。
在前端开发方面,可以使用HTML和JavaScript来实现动态表单。可以通过JavaScript动态地添加或删除表单字段,并使用HTML的表单元素来定义字段的类型和属性。
在后端开发方面,可以使用服务器端编程语言(如Java、Python、Node.js等)来处理表单提交的数据。可以将表单数据保存到数据库中,以便后续使用或分析。
在数据库方面,可以使用关系型数据库(如MySQL、PostgreSQL等)或非关系型数据库(如MongoDB、Redis等)来存储表单数据。可以根据具体需求选择合适的数据库类型。
在云原生方面,可以使用容器技术(如Docker)来打包和部署应用程序。可以将应用程序和相关依赖项打包成一个容器镜像,并使用容器编排工具(如Kubernetes)来管理和扩展容器。
在网络通信和网络安全方面,可以使用HTTPS协议来加密数据传输,确保数据的安全性。可以使用防火墙、入侵检测系统(IDS)等网络安全设备来保护服务器和应用程序免受攻击。
在音视频和多媒体处理方面,可以使用音视频编解码库(如FFmpeg)来处理音视频数据。可以对上传的音视频文件进行转码、剪辑、合并等操作,以满足不同的需求。
在人工智能方面,可以使用机器学习和深度学习算法来对表单数据进行分析和预测。可以使用图像识别、自然语言处理等技术来提取和理解表单中的信息。
在物联网方面,可以将表单与物联网设备进行关联,实现远程监控和控制。可以通过传感器获取物联网设备的数据,并将数据上传到云平台进行处理和分析。
在移动开发方面,可以使用移动应用开发框架(如React Native、Flutter等)来开发适用于移动设备的表单应用。可以将表单应用发布到应用商店,供用户下载和使用。
在存储方面,可以使用云存储服务(如腾讯云对象存储COS)来存储表单中的文件和图片。可以通过API调用来上传、下载和管理存储的文件。
在区块链方面,可以使用区块链技术来确保表单数据的不可篡改性和可追溯性。可以将表单数据的哈希值存储到区块链上,以便后续验证数据的完整性。
在元宇宙方面,可以将表单应用嵌入到虚拟现实(VR)或增强现实(AR)环境中,实现更加沉浸式和交互式的表单填写体验。
腾讯云相关产品推荐:
领取专属 10元无门槛券
手把手带您无忧上云